Output 628e9db7c9e0e25b6fe411c58dd6d07e522565ad6ec469f3dc32a494b30a0ddc:0

value
1716484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c56522541b816351f1ad46cbdfa8eab42ed5a6d OP_EQUAL
address
38eegoWx9P3vpyK6vJDsZ9Vg1BT6tg5qzH
transaction
628e9db7c9e0e25b6fe411c58dd6d07e522565ad6ec469f3dc32a494b30a0ddc
confirmations
361739
spent
true